Performance metrics

Collect and use metrics to measure the performance of storage systems that are monitored by IBM Storage Insights Pro. Metrics are also collected to measure the performance of switches that are monitored.

You must deploy one or more data collectors to collect performance metadata. The metadata is collected, analyzed, and mined to gain valuable insights into the performance of your storage systems and their internal resources, such as pools and volumes. You also gain insights into switch performance through the collection of performance metadata for physical switches, switch ports, and Trunks.

With the metadata that is collected, historical and current performance charts are generated. You can use the charts to compare the performance of your storage resources over time, identify and troubleshoot performance anomalies, and compare the key performance indicators from your storage systems that run IBM Storage Virtualize with best practice guidelines.

Similarly, you can use historical and current performance charts to compare the performance of your switches over time, identify and troubleshoot performance anomalies, and compare key performance indicators from switches and ports.

Time zone determination: The time zone of the browser that you use to access IBM Storage Insights determines when the data is collected and the date and time that is shown in the chart and table views.
